Hardik Pandya seeks blessings with Mahieka Sharma before England showdown
Indian cricketer Hardik Pandya and his girlfriend Mahieka Sharma were spotted at Mumbai's Siddhivinayak Temple ahead of a crucial match against England. The visit, seen as a moment of reflection before the high-stakes game, quickly gained attention online. Fans shared images of the couple wrapped in a single shawl, standing close together in prayer.
The pair sought blessings at the famous Lord Ganesha temple, a tradition many athletes follow before important events. Photos of their visit spread rapidly on social media, with supporters calling it a touching gesture before the England clash.
Public reaction to Pandya's temple visits has shifted over time. Between 2022 and 2023, his appearances at religious sites drew mixed responses, often overshadowed by debates around his IPL captaincy and personal life. But by 2024, perceptions changed after his pivotal role in India's T20 World Cup win that June. His marriage to Natasa Stankovic and family moments further softened criticism, with fans now viewing his devotion as a sign of humility and gratitude.
This latest visit with Sharma continues that trend. The couple's shared shawl and quiet prayers were seen as a unifying moment before the match, reinforcing Pandya's image as both a dedicated athlete and a private individual.
The temple trip has reignited discussions about Pandya's personal and professional journey. Once a polarising figure, his recent achievements and public gestures have earned wider admiration. For now, the focus remains on the upcoming match—and whether the blessings will bring success on the field.
